Bitcoin, the granddaddy of crypto, remains a stalwart despite its energy-intensive proof-of-work consensus. The competition for block rewards is fierce, requiring miners to deploy cutting-edge ASICs. But even within the Bitcoin mining sphere, nuances exist. Factors like energy costs and pool fees significantly impact profitability. Is a slightly older, cheaper ASIC with a lower hash rate but better power efficiency a better choice than the newest, most powerful, but electricity-guzzling beast? This question needs rigorous cost-benefit analysis tailored to your specific operational environment.

Ethereum, having transitioned to Proof-of-Stake (PoS), no longer relies on GPU mining for its main chain. However, the spirit of mining lives on through Ethereum Classic (ETC) and other GPU-minable coins. While not as profitable as ETH mining used to be, ETC provides an alternative for miners who have invested in GPU mining rigs. Evaluating the potential of these alternative coins requires staying abreast of market trends and understanding their long-term viability.

Beyond the hardware, consider the infrastructure required to support your mining operation. This includes a reliable internet connection, a stable power supply, and adequate cooling to prevent overheating. In many cases, hosting your mining rigs at a specialized facility may be a more cost-effective option than running them at home. Hosting services offer numerous benefits, including access to cheaper electricity, professional maintenance, and enhanced security. Carefully evaluate the pros and cons of self-hosting versus hosting to determine the best approach for your specific situation.

The debate between ASICs and GPUs continues. ASICs offer superior hash rates for specific algorithms, making them the go-to choice for mining Bitcoin and other SHA-256 coins. However, their lack of versatility is a significant drawback. GPUs, on the other hand, can be used to mine a wider range of cryptocurrencies, offering greater flexibility and potentially mitigating risk. If you’re looking for a more adaptable mining solution, a GPU rig might be a better choice, especially if you’re interested in exploring different altcoins.
